Zauba

AUTOCON%20ENGINEERS%20(INDIA)%20PRIVATE%20LIMITEDCIN: U28193KA2025PTC204080
new.inc
AUTOCON ENGINEERS (INDIA) PRIVATE LIMITED | Zauba